WebWhat does RG 230 say about disclosing non-IFRS financial information in the statutory financial report? RG 230 (section C) does not permit non-IFRS profit measures/information to be presented within the body of the statutory financial report (i.e. the financial statements and the notes). WebOn 3 November 2024, at COP26, the IFRS Foundation Trustees announced the creation of the International Sustainability Standards Board (ISSB). The ISSB will deliver a global baseline of sustainability disclosures to meet capital market needs. WebIFRS 12.7IFRS 12 requires disclosure of the significant judgements and assumptions that an entity has made in determining the nature of its interest in another entity or arrangement. It also contains extensive disclosure requirements for subsidiaries, associates, joint ventures and unconsolidated structured entities.
